About This Opportunity

The Charlie Perkins Scholarships are postgraduate scholarships directed towards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ander Australians who have the potential to become leaders in their field of study and in their communities. The Scholarships were launched in 2009 in the memory of leader and activist Dr Charlie Perkins - the first Aboriginal person in Australia to graduate from university. With the assistance of the University of Oxford and the Cambridge Commonwealth, European and International Trust, these annual scholarships support talented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ander Australians to undertake postgraduate study at the University of Oxford or the University of Cambridge. Since the program's inception fifteen years ago, 34 Charlie Perkins Scholars have been accepted into full-time studies at these universities, with 31 having graduated to date. The Charlie Perkins Scholarship Trust is administered by the Aurora Education Foundation, and a panel of prominent Indigenous and non-Indigenous Australians, together with representatives from the British Government and Cambridge Australia Scholarships, select the scholars each year.
